Understanding the Type of Dishwasher I Use
Before I buy any detergent, I make sure it matches my dish machine. Some detergents are made for low-temp machines, while others are designed for high-temp systems. I always check whether my machine needs liquid, powder, or solid detergent, because using the wrong type can lead to poor cleaning results or machine issues.
Cleaning Power and Soil Type
I consider the kind of food soil I deal with every day. For heavy grease, baked-on food, and protein residues, I need a stronger formula. If my kitchen handles mostly light loads, I may not need the most aggressive option. I’ve found that the best detergent is the one that removes my typical mess without damaging dishes or glassware.
Water Hardness Matters to Me
One thing I never ignore is water hardness. Hard water can leave spots, film, and mineral buildup on dishes and inside the machine. I look for detergents with built-in water softening or boosting agents if my water supply is hard. This helps me get cleaner results and reduces scale buildup over time.
Safety and Material Compatibility
I always check whether the detergent is safe for my dishware, utensils, and machine components. Some formulas can be too harsh for delicate glassware or certain metals. I also prefer products that are easy to handle and store safely, especially in busy commercial kitchens where spills can happen.
Concentration and Cost Efficiency
When I compare products, I don’t just look at the container price. I check how much detergent I actually need per wash cycle. A concentrated detergent may cost more upfront but last longer and save money in the long run. For me, value means strong performance with less product waste.
Rinse Aid and Additive Compatibility
I like to know whether the detergent works well with rinse aids and other cleaning additives. In my experience, the best results often come from a balanced system that includes detergent, rinse aid, and proper water temperature. If the detergent is compatible with my setup, I get better drying and fewer spots.
Environmental and Health Considerations
I also pay attention to the ingredients. If I can find a detergent that is effective but still environmentally responsible, I prefer that. I look for low-phosphate or biodegradable options when possible, and I consider whether the product has strong fumes or requires extra protective handling.
Packaging and Storage Convenience
In a commercial setting, packaging matters more than people think. I prefer detergents that are easy to pour, store, and measure. If the container is bulky or awkward, it slows down my workflow. Clear labeling and secure packaging help me avoid mistakes and keep my storage area organized.
